Pakistan is likely to celebrate Eid-ul-Fitr on Monday, March 31, 2025, according to the Ruet-e-Hilal Research Council’s latest forecast.


Shawwal Moon Sighting Prediction

Khalid Ijaz Mufti, Secretary General of the Ruet-e-Hilal Research Council, stated that the Shawwal moon is expected to be visible across Pakistan on the evening of Sunday, March 30, provided that weather conditions are favorable.

Moon Visibility Criteria:

  • The new moon will be born on March 29 at 3:58 PM (Pakistan time).
  • By March 30 at sunset, the moon will be over 26 hours old, making it easily visible.
  • The minimum age for visibility is 18 hours, with at least 40 minutes between sunset and moonset—conditions that will be met in various parts of Pakistan.

Final Decision by Ruet-e-Hilal Committee

While the research council has provided its scientific prediction, the final decision will be made by the Central Ruet-e-Hilal Committee, led by Maulana Abdul Khabir Azad, during its official meeting on March 30.

Eid-ul-Fitr Celebrations in Pakistan

Eid-ul-Fitr, marking the end of Ramadan, is one of Pakistan’s most significant religious occasions. The day is observed with:

  • Special prayers in mosques and Eidgahs
  • Family gatherings and celebrations
  • Festive meals, including traditional sweets like Sheer Khurma
